Subject: [PATCH 0/6] ARM: shmobile: rcar: Drop lehacy SYSC fallbacks
Date: Wed, 30 May 2018 17:25:10 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1527693916-11215-1-git-send-email-geert+renesas@glider.be> (raw)

	Hi Simon, Magnus,

When DT SYSC support was introduced in v4.7, legacy fallbacks were kept
to keep secondary CPUs working on R-Car H1, H2, and M2-W using old DTBs.
However, the time has come to drop these fallbacks, and clean up the
resulting code.

Most of this was written when I worked on DT SYSC support, but postponed
until the time was ripe.  So basically I've been running this during the
last +2 years.

I avoided touching drivers/soc/renesas and arch/arm/mach-shmobile code
in the same patch.  If you prefer some patches to be squashed, please
let me know.

Tested on Marzen (R-Car H1), Lager (R-Car H2), and Koelsch (R-Car M2-W).
